Acrobat Essentials

2 Days: $750.00

Users explore how Acrobat technology works within the structure of today's workplace and receive a solid foundation for applying Acrobat features to these real-world situations. The hands-on curriculum specifically addresses the demands of users who want to create visually rich documents that communicate effectively with clients and colleagues in all industries.

This class is for people who need to learn the essential fundamental aspects of working with Acrobat and producing pdf files. No prior eperience is necessary though people with some prior experience may also be interested in attending.

This course gives users the skills they need to work efficiently with the components of Adobe Acrobat software, including PDF Writer and Acrobat Distiller. Both static and interactive pdf files will be explored and produced.

Familiarity with Windows.
